Qarhan salt lake is the depocenter and catchment of the basin, which is in the central south part of the Qaidam Basin, the southern of Qarhan salt lake near the Kunlun mountains, the northern next to the Xitieshan and the Luliangshan, which are the branch range of Qilian mountains, the west is reaching to Taijinar salt lake, the east is adjacent to the Qaidam river. Its climate is a typical kind of continental desert climate, which is characterized by high altitude, low temperature, rare precipitation. Therefore, the wind-sand activity is frequently which lead to that the distribution of Aeolian landform is widely in Qarhan salt lake area, the important information of the formation and evolution for the Aeolian landform recorded in the characteristic of grain size, which can explore the sources of sedimentary and also analysis the deposited environment. In order to do the research, based on field investigation, the author collected the sedimentary of different regions, different landform types, different positions of landform, according to the theory of Aeolia geomorphology; the author analyzed the characteristic of grain size, mineral composition. The main conclusions are following:(1)The grain size composition analysis shows that the sediments of the area is mainly comprised of medium and fine sand, the frequency curve is unimodal, the peaks, range of grain size is similar in different regions, but it is broad in the different landform types.(2)The grain size parameters shows that the mean grain size of the southern is finer than the northern, the difference of grain size parameters is obviously in different regions and landform types. The trend of grain size parameters varied with the depth is clear.(3)The study of the relation between grain size characteristic and the downwind direction shows that it is unclear in large scale range of different landforms, but with the downwind direction in small scale range, the mean grain size became finer, the sort is better.(4)The deposited environment of the sedimentary in the area is very complicated, the main deposited environment is Aeolian, the following is lacustrine, deltaic, diluvial, lakeshore. The environment of surface sediments is mainly Aeolian and lacustrine facies, its distribution haven, t regional, but with the depth the deposited environment is stratified.(5)The mean content of heavy minerals of the sediments in the Qarhan salt lake area is0.88%,the variation of the heavy mineral content is broad. The types of heavy minerals in the area are various. The assemblage of the stability of heavy minerals is dominated by unstable mineral, the proportion of extremely stable mineral is lest, but the kind is the most. The characteristic index analysis of different regions, different landform types and different positions shows that the heavy mineral is complicated and the distance form the provenance is different. The rock of the provenance is uniform, but is also related to the geological structure of the surrounding mountains.(6)In contrast with Badan Jaran Desert and Tenngger Desert, the sediments in the area surrounding to Qarhan salt lake are finer, but the content of heavy minerals is higher. So it seem that the Aeolian sand in the research area came form the fluvio-lacustrine deposits formed in the tertiary and quaternary period in the Qaidam Basin.
